First
Aid
There is a legal requirement for all employers to assess
the level of first aid cover and equipment at work.
The first step to meet this legal requirment is to train your staff.

First Aid For Child Carers
This is an accredited course to the National Childminding Association
and the Pre School Learning Alliance. It also meets the First Aid elements
for NVQ's in Childcare. This 12-hour course normally presented over four
evenings covers all aspects of First Aid and its Management for Child
Carers, as well as meeting OFSTED's requirements
